Joy Division formed in Manchester, England, in 1976, during a time when punk was exploding and the music scene was hungry for something new. What they created was a darker, more thoughtful version of punk energy. Their music mixed driving basslines, echoing guitars, and Ian Curtis’s haunting baritone vocals. The result was a sound that felt both urgent and distant, like someone shouting into an empty room. That tension is exactly what keeps listeners coming back, especially in the US, where fans of alternative, indie, and post-punk music still treat Joy Division as a foundational influence.

Which songs, albums or moments define Joy Division?

To understand Joy Division, it helps to start with their most iconic songs and albums. “Love Will Tear Us Apart” is often the first track people hear, and for good reason. It’s a perfect example of how the band could balance emotional vulnerability with a driving, danceable rhythm. The song’s themes of love, loss, and emotional distance still feel incredibly relatable, especially for listeners in the US who are navigating complex relationships and personal struggles.

Another defining track is “She’s Lost Control,” which explores themes of mental health and emotional breakdown. The song’s repetitive structure and haunting vocals create a sense of unease that mirrors the subject matter. For many fans, this track is a powerful reminder of how music can address difficult topics in a way that feels both artistic and honest. Joy Division’s ability to tackle these themes without sensationalizing them is part of what makes their music so enduring.

Joy Division’s debut album, “Unknown Pleasures,” is a landmark release that continues to be celebrated by critics and fans alike. The album’s dark, atmospheric sound and introspective lyrics set the tone for much of what would come in post-punk and alternative music. Tracks like “Disorder” and “New Dawn Fades” showcase the band’s ability to create tension and release through their arrangements, making the album a cohesive and immersive listening experience.

The band’s second and final studio album, “Closer,” further solidified their legacy. Released after the death of frontman Ian Curtis, the album feels even more intense and emotionally charged. Songs like “Atmosphere” and “Decades” capture a sense of longing and reflection that resonates with listeners who are grappling with their own experiences of loss and change. “Closer” is often cited as one of the greatest albums of all time, and its influence can be heard in the work of countless artists who followed.
